Naukrijobs UK
Register
London Jobs
Manchester Jobs
Liverpool Jobs
Nottingham Jobs
Birmingham Jobs
Cambridge Jobs
Glasgow Jobs
Bristol Jobs
Wales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Senior Software Engineer - C# and React

Job LocationLondon
EducationNot Mentioned
SalaryCompetitive salary
IndustryNot Mentioned
Functional AreaNot Mentioned
Job TypePermanent , full-time

Job Description

Senior Software Engineer – C# and React -London£110k - £140 base + bonus & great benefits 12-month Fixed Term Contract (FTC) -hybrid (2 days pw in City)Hybrid model (2 days in office per week). We are looking for a Mid - Senior Software Engineer to join The Trading Execution team for a trillion dollar fund manager based in the city of London.The main scope of the work will be to design and develop new capabilities for our clients global trading desk. The key technical requirement is proven experience building reactive architectures (using frameworks such as Reactive Extensions or RxJS) and understandshow to use Domain Driven Design to ensure the core domain code has a tight affinity with the conceptual model. They will likely come from a strong C# background with current React experience.This is a unique opportunity to be cross-trained into FDC3 and the latest interop.io desktop containers (OpenFin, Finsemble, Glue42) but if you even know what one of these are, then you’re pretty much guaranteed an interview.Role summary and job responsibilities

  • Contributing to the development of standard methodologies within your group
  • Leading code reviews and actively participates in providing feedback on others’ designs/code
  • Being accountable for technical debt in your own software
  • Taking control of complex problems and step through them in a rational way
  • Making tactical vs. strategic trade-offs
  • Being flexible in your thinking; able to evolve a solution when additional information or ideas are presented
  • Actively helping team members/make suggestions to improve practices
  • Demonstrates strong logic and reasoning capabilities
  • Providing on-call support as needed
Business knowledge
  • Preference given to anyone with an understanding of front office Financial Markets
  • Able to work directly with business partners
  • Decisions show a focus on current and future business priorities, together with fiscal responsibility
  • Can articulate business needs and translate them into technology solutions
Desired Experience:
  • BS or MS Degree in a technical discipline and 5+ years of demonstrated hands-on software engineering experience. Additional experience may substitute for degree.
  • Experience with React and UI testing frameworks (such as Selenium or Playwright)
  • Programs proficiently in several languages (C# .Net preferred) and is comfortable switching between them
  • Knowledge of SQL, Relational Database Concepts and Stored Procedures
  • Experience building applications and deploying to public or private clouds, such as Amazon Web Services (AWS), Microsoft Azure, or similar providers preferred
  • Strong Test-Driven Development and desire to write simple, adaptive, and iterative code
  • Experience working in a dynamic, fast-paced, Agile team environment
  • Enthusiasm for learning & results oriented
  • Develops data models or schemas from scratch and knows of key concepts such as ACID, Normalization, and Transactions
  • Debugs large components with limited assistance and assists other engineers
  • AWS experience is a strong plus
  • Financial industry experience is a plusbut not a requirement (as ALL industry backgrounds welcome
  • Able to operate with openness and efficiency with one or more Agile methodologies (e.g., Scrum)
  • Actively seeks feedback and guidance to improve technical skills (e.g., through submitting work for code review)
  • Debugs and fixes your own software with minimal assistance
  • Practices automated testing and tests your work in an automated and repeatable way

APPLY NOW

Senior Software Engineer - C# and React Related Jobs

© 2019 Naukrijobs All Rights Reserved